- Highlights of the live CBS telecast, "The Dark, Dark Hours" first broadcast on the General Electric Theater on Sunday December 12, 1954.
It was only broadcast once.
IMPORTANT NOTE: Footage from this TV broadcast appeared in Michael Sheridan's 2005 documentary James Dean: Forever Young.
This clip was edited by Wayne Federman, who discovered the entire program while researching a Reagan television retrospective for the Reagan Centennial.
James Dean, fresh from shooting East of Eden (a role which earned him an Oscar nomination), was on the precipice of film stardom. He died in a car crash less than one year after this broadcast.
Ronald Reagan, a movie actor since 1937, was beginning a new phase of his career as a television host (although still a frequent actor). His work with GE led him into politics and he was elected Governor of California 12 years after this broadcast.

Fun fact: Ronald Reagan was fired from hosting General Electric Theater in 1962 after he criticized the TVA, an agency that gave federal government contracts to GE. His son Michael has suggested that Bobby Kennedy, who was Attorney General in his brother's Cabinet at the time, threatened to withhold future contracts unless the show was cancelled or Reagan was fired, and GE chose the latter.
Two years later, the TVA was also the subject of a Democrat attack ad against Barry Goldwater in the 1964 presidential campaign, which quoted Goldwater as endorsing a sale of the agency.
